Che cosa è un file AXD?

February 19

Che cosa è un file AXD?


ASP.NET è un ambiente di sviluppo per la creazione di pagine Web dinamiche. Tutte le pagine web arrivano al browser web formattato in HTML, Hypertext Markup Language. Tuttavia, non tutti si siedono sul server Web in quello stato. pagine web dinamiche generano di programmi come quelli sviluppati da ASP.NET. L'ambiente ASP.NET per le pagine Web include due file con l'estensione del file AXD.

Servizi web

I servizi Web sono piccole applicazioni che sono incorporati nelle pagine Web. Un esempio potrebbe essere un ticker azionario, o un contatore visitatore. L'effettiva applicazione è da qualche residente altro che il server in cui la pagina Web principale risiede. L'applicazione integrata potrebbe anche essere scaricato sul computer del cliente. L'approvvigionamento e l'accesso di questi servizi integrati è gestito da un file chiamato WebResource.axd. Questo file viene definito un "gestore". Esso contiene una parte di codice che è responsabile per il recupero del servizio Web incorporato.

Servizi script

Quando un'applicazione embedded viene scaricato sul computer client, la pagina Web ASP-creato ha bisogno di più di un semplice WebResource.axd per attivarlo. Un programma ASP.NET potrebbe contenere script che non generano HTML, ma dovrebbe essere scritto nella pagina in uscita. Un esempio di questo tipo di codice è un JavaScript che convalida l'input dell'utente inserito in una pagina Web prima che l'azione utente viene inviato al server. L'iniezione di questa categoria di codice in una pagina Web generata è gestito da ScriptResource.axd. Il programma ScriptResource.axd non viene chiamato direttamente. Viene richiamato da una chiamata a una funzione nel Toolkit ASP.NET AJAX Control.

file di traccia

Un altro esempio di un file AXD utilizzato in ASP.NET è trace.axd. Questo vede tutti gli eventi registrati in un file di log per una sessione per una pagina Web specificata. Trace.axd è un gestore HTTP per i file di log. Il trace.axd non popola i file di registro. Questa azione è gestito da routine tracce incorporato nella pagina Web.

Altri file AXD

Il gestore ASP.NET non è l'unico tipo di file che utilizza l'estensione del file AXD. Avery etichette Pro, ora chiamato Design Pro, è un pacchetto software per la progettazione e la stampa di etichette. Esso utilizza l'estensione del file AXD per un file di indice. È un pacchetto di disegno tecnico da parte di Autodesk, Inc. Esso utilizza anche l'estensione del file AXD.